Inland Empire hospital to close maternity unit amid low birth rates

A hospital in the Inland Empire announced Friday that it will be cutting services to its maternity unit next year following a decline in the number of births.

Corona Regional Medical Center officials declined to comment to NBC4 about the announcement, but the closure of the maternity unit was published on its website.

According to their social media page, the closure is scheduled for Jan. 30, 2026, and the last patient will be seen on the 23rd of that month…
